Handbook of the Birds of India and Pakistan: Stone Curlews to Owls

This enormous ten-volume sequence, the 1st quantity of which was once released in 1996, is the main accomplished and trustworthy reference paintings at the birds of the Indian subcontinent. A completely revised moment variation with new plates, textual content revisions, and the addition of latest subspecies, it comprises information regarding long-range migration and taxonomic alterations, besides lifestyles historical past details, bills of habit, ecology, and distribution and migration files.

Till around 1967, the Indian Naga hostiles avoided any fraternization with the Burmese Nagas lest this create difficulties in their relations with the Burmese Army. The position changed in 1967 after the Indian Naga hostiles joined hands with sections of the Burmese Nagas and the two called for a Greater Nagaland, consisting of the Naga majority areas on both sides of the Indo-Burmese border. This created serious concern in Rangoon and the Burmese Army headquarters in Rangoon asked its field units to stop the use of the Burmese territory by the Indian Naga hostiles for going to East Pakistan.
